After losing the Dunk Contest, Paul George calls the Dunk Contest ‘a joke’
First, Indiana’s Paul George dunked over Roy Hibbert and Dahntay Jones which was okay. Then, he dunked with lights off while wearing a glow-in-the-dark jersey that was cute, I guess. Lastly, he dunked while sticking a Larry Bird sticker on the backboard after multiple attempts. And to George, and apparently his teammates, that should’ve been enough to take home the Dunk Contest...

Pacers clobber Warriors for 5th straight win
No last second heroics from George Hill this time. The Indiana Pacers returned from the All-Star break in form, pummeling the Golden State Warriors 102-78, in a game that wasn't even as close as the score suggested.Good game for Granger, who had 25 points in just 30 minutes while taking just 18 shots, but it was an all round team effort. Pacers have concerns entering second half of season
Thirty-three games are in the books and 33 remain as the Indiana Pacers host Golden State tonight. The top two positions in the Eastern Conference are all but determined, with the only suspense revolving around whether Miami or Chicago winds up with the best record.
